Loess wall "Nine Mauna"

Nine Mauna in Großriedenthal

The Nine Mauna (nine men) is a loess wall in Großriedenthal that was declared a natural monument in 1979 .

The characteristic, up to 25 meters high protrusions from the loess wall were created by weathering and erosion of the calcareous loess. The Gösingen pastor and local researcher Lambert Karner found tunnels of earth stalls below this loess formation .
